Cryptocurrency users, an important update from Upbit has just emerged. The leading South Korean exchange has announced a temporary Upbit Polygon suspension, halting all deposits and withdrawals on the Polygon network. This critical development, citing an unspecified network issue, impacts users relying on Polygon for their transactions.

What Exactly Caused the Urgent Upbit Polygon Suspension?

Upbit’s official statement points to an ‘unspecified network issue’ as the primary reason for the temporary halt. While the exact technical details remain undisclosed, such suspensions are often a precautionary measure. Exchanges implement these to safeguard user funds and maintain network integrity when they detect anomalies, potential vulnerabilities, or performance degradation on a specific blockchain. This ensures a secure environment for all users during the Upbit Polygon suspension.

Network issues can stem from various sources, including unexpected spikes in transaction volume, software bugs, or even routine maintenance that uncovers deeper problems. Exchanges like Upbit prioritize the stability and security of their platforms. Therefore, a temporary suspension, though inconvenient, is a proactive step to prevent potential losses or operational disruptions for their user base. Understanding this context helps alleviate concerns and highlights the exchange’s commitment to responsible operation.

How Does This Upbit Polygon Suspension Affect Your Crypto Activities?

For users holding assets on the Polygon network within Upbit, this suspension has immediate implications for their crypto activities. It’s vital to understand these impacts to manage your digital assets effectively:

  • No Deposits or Withdrawals: You currently cannot move assets like MATIC or other Polygon-based tokens into or out of your Upbit account. This directly affects liquidity and the ability to transfer funds to other wallets or exchanges.
  • Trading May Continue: Typically, internal trading of Polygon-based assets within the exchange’s order books is unaffected, allowing users to buy and sell. However, this depends on Upbit’s specific policy during the suspension.
  • Fund Safety: It is crucial to remember that a suspension of this nature usually means your funds are secure, but access is temporarily restricted. Upbit’s priority is often user asset protection during such events, preventing any potential exploitation of the detected network issue.
  • Impact on DApps: If you use Upbit as a gateway to decentralized applications (DApps) on Polygon, this suspension will temporarily hinder your ability to fund or withdraw from those applications via Upbit.

This Upbit Polygon suspension means users should plan accordingly for their crypto movements and monitor the situation closely.

Why Are Such Network Suspensions Necessary for Crypto Security?

The decision by Upbit to implement a temporary Upbit Polygon suspension, though disruptive, underscores a fundamental principle in cryptocurrency security: proactive risk management. Blockchain networks, while robust, are complex systems that can encounter unforeseen technical glitches, congestion, or even potential security vulnerabilities. When an exchange detects such an issue, a temporary halt of services on the affected network is often the most responsible course of action.

This preventative measure serves several vital purposes. Firstly, it safeguards user assets from potential loss or unauthorized access that could arise from a compromised network. Secondly, it provides the exchange’s technical team with the necessary time and space to thoroughly investigate the problem, implement a fix, and ensure the network’s stability before resuming operations. Without such precautions, users could face significant financial risks. Thus, these suspensions, while inconvenient, ultimately contribute to a safer and more reliable crypto trading environment.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: What does “Upbit Polygon suspension” mean for my funds?
A: Your funds are generally safe. The suspension is a temporary measure by Upbit to protect assets while they address a network issue. You just can’t deposit or withdraw Polygon-based assets for now.

Q2: Can I still trade Polygon assets on Upbit during the suspension?
A: Typically, internal trading on the exchange remains active, allowing you to buy or sell Polygon-based assets against other cryptocurrencies within Upbit. However, it’s always best to confirm Upbit’s specific policy through their official announcements.

Q3: How long will the Upbit Polygon suspension last?
A: The duration is unspecified. Upbit will announce the resumption of services once the network issue is resolved. It’s best to monitor their official channels for real-time updates.

Q4: What should I do if I need to move my Polygon assets urgently?
A: During the suspension, direct deposits or withdrawals on the Polygon network via Upbit are not possible. You might need to wait for the service to resume or consider if you have assets on other exchanges or wallets that are not affected.

Q5: Is this a common occurrence in the crypto world?
A: Yes, temporary network suspensions are relatively common across cryptocurrency exchanges. They are usually precautionary measures to address technical issues, ensure security, and maintain the integrity of the platform and user funds.
